  • [Update] Nokia Publishes Policy on Conflict Minerals

    "Conflict minerals," those mined to support groups conducting armed conflict or engaging in human rights abuses, have been an issue since long before we first wrote about it in July of 2010.   • [Video] NASA Releases 1st Footage of the "Dark Side" of the Moon

    NASA's Gravity Recovery and Interior Laboratory (GRAIL) mission has released the first footage shot of the moon's far side.
